How does SRTC interact with Kootenai Metropolitan Planning Organization (KMPO)?
A. Communities with an urbanized population of 50,000 or more are mandated to have a Metropolitan Planning Organization (MPO). The 2000 census confirmed that Kootenai County has a population of 70,000. The Kootenai Metropolitan Planning Organization (KMPO) was formed after the 2000 census confirmed that Kootenai County has a population of 70,000. KMPO addresses the county’s transportation planning needs and provides a coordinated planning effort between the public, cities, small towns, the county, the state, transit providers and tribes. The KMPO Board has contracted with Spokane Regional Transportation Council (SRTC) the MPO for Spokane County, for day-to-day operational and administrative needs.
